Which hormone is primarily responsible for lowering blood glucose levels?
Glucagon
Insulin
Adrenaline
Cortisol
Answer explanation
Insulin is the hormone primarily responsible for lowering blood glucose levels by facilitating the uptake of glucose into cells, thus reducing blood sugar levels. Glucagon, adrenaline, and cortisol have the opposite effect.
